`
happmaoo
  • 浏览: 4342137 次
  • 性别: Icon_minigender_1
  • 来自: 杭州
社区版块
存档分类
最新评论

译《Perl语言指南》中的随想

阅读更多

突然想说几句,前几天与同事聊天时谈到计算机编程,不就那么点东西吗,总归离不开这三条语句:if … else, while, switch, 说到这,我们都笑,笑计算机语言的机械化,笑程序员被计算机语言所控,同时,也夹杂着一丝对计算机语言理解的傲慢。直到最近些天看到更多有关Perl语言的发明者Larry Wall的文章时,我笑不出来了,因为我从Perl语言的身上对计算机语言有了重新的认识,并对自已的无知感到羞愧。<?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" />

其实在前面几篇关于Perl语言的译文中已有所感受,但一直无法用恰当的语言来表述,只好引用 传奇程序员Larry Wall:Perl的乐趣 Wall的原话代述:


Perl
对真实生活的反映--他的人性特征--是内建于这门语言的深厚的哲学结构.Perl,第一个后现代的计算机语言,一个人造自然语言,模拟了程序员是如何思考的


Per
已经给你创造力的空间.如果你想能够为不同的事情做优化--如果你想能够用同一种语言开处方,作诗,写报纸专栏和杂志专题--他就必须具有灵活性.这与人们在计算机科学中学到的截然不同.人们被教导如果有任何冗余,那就是有害的,恶劣的.从自然语言的角度看,我不买它(指计算机科学的教导)的帐

Perl
不但连接了C程序员的世界和UnixShell的世界,或者连接了计算机世界的数字服务和人类现实不成熟的混乱.Perl还在自由软件世界的两个极端之间架设了一座桥梁...

分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ics